# Onboarded, paid, three days in — then: “you never accepted the offer”

**[TRUE STORY]** — by New hire · via r/recruitinghell

A new hire finished onboarding, set up direct deposit and worked Tuesday through Thursday before an email landed titled “Revocation of Employment Offer.” Its stated reasoning: the offer “was never accepted.” They had, by that point, been an employee for three days. r/recruitinghell couldn't decide whether to laugh or draft a complaint.
